人工智能

AI 代码助手对比:对开发者工具链的影响与选型要点

2026年6月29日 · admin
openmagic ad

引言:AI 代码助手的崛起与工具链变革

近期,AI 代码助手在开发者工具链中的渗透不断深入。它们通过理解上下文、补全代码、生成实现、以及快速重构,正在改变日常编码方式、测试与上线节奏。本篇从功能特性、集成方式、对工作流的影响以及选型要点出发,提供一个对比视角,帮助开发团队在不丢失代码控制力的前提下,提升效率与协作能力。

功能对比要点:从单点产出到整条工作流的协同

主流 AI 代码助手在代码补全、模板生成、问题定位与重构建议等方面各有侧重。关键在于能否无缝融入现有编辑器、CI/CD、测试与代码审查,而非单纯给出一段代码。不同工具在对特定语言、框架的支持深度、对大型代码库的上下文理解能力以及对私有代码的保护策略上存在差异。

  • 语言覆盖与上下文感知:对主流语言的理解,越能准确定位上下文,越能减少打断式编辑。
  • 安全与隐私:是否将代码片段上传云端,是否提供本地推断模式,以及对数据的缓释策略。
  • 集成深度:与 IDE、版本控制、lint/格式化工具、测试框架的原生集成程度。
  • 团队协作:对协作规范、代码风格、审查流程的支持,如同义模板与可追溯的改动记录。

工具生态对比:代表性能力的差异化解读

在市场上,常见的 AI 代码助手各有侧重:有偏向大语言模型的通用补全能力,有强调在特定框架中对上下文的深度理解的实现,也有强调本地化推断以强化私有代码保护的方案。选择时应关注对现有工具链的非破坏性兼容、以及在团队需求中的“痛点覆盖度”与“体验一致性”。

  1. 通用型助手:在多语言、多框架上提供广泛的补全和模板,适合跨项目型团队。
  2. 框架定制型助手:对特定技术栈(如前端、后端微服务、数据处理)有更深的模板与重构建议。
  3. 本地推断/私有化工具:强调数据隐私和离线能力,适合含敏感代码库的企业。

对开发流程的实际影响

AI 代码助手会改变以下环节的工作节奏:需求理解 → 设计草案生成 → 代码实现快速迭代 → 测试与审查。在实践中,能显著降低模板化、重复性编码的耗时,但也需要团队建立合适的使用规范,避免过度依赖导致的代码风格偏离与潜在的安全风险。

选型建议:从需求出发,结合团队规模与安全策略

在选型时,建议关注以下要点:1)语言与框架兼容性、2)编辑器与工作流的集成度、3)数据隐私与本地化选项、4)团队协作与审查的支持。小型团队可优先考虑易用、可无缝接入的通用方案;中大型团队则需评估对私有代码的保护、复用模板的治理能力以及对 CI/CD 的影响。最终的成功在于“工具成为生产力的放大器”,而非新的学习成本与约束。若能在初期设定好代码风格、审查准则与数据使用边界,长期收益将显著高于短期的便捷性。

结论:AI 代码助手是开发者工具链的增强器

AI 代码助手不是要替代人类开发者,而是通过 提升一致性、加速重复工作、强化知识分享,来释放开发者的创造力。正确的选型与治理,能让团队在保持控制力的同时,享受以智能辅助为驱动的高产与高质产出。